Tesse is located in West Hollywood, United States on 8500 Sunset Blvd Suite B. Tesse is rated 4.6 out of 5 in the category modern european restaurant in United States. Tesse is a French restaurant featuring the dynamic, continental-inspired cuisine of Chef Raphael Francois and Pastry Chef Sally Camacho Mueller, served in a ...|Tesse is a collaboration between restauranteur Bill Chait, Michelin-starred ef Raphael Francois, pastry guru Sally Camacho, and managing partner and wine director, Jordan Ogron. Tesse marries contemporary French cuisine with innovative cocktails and a unique wine program, to create a truly singular dining experience.

I really can't put into words how wonderful this restaurant is. Sunset hour menu had great food and drink, and we took full advantage. Regular menu too. Pate and charred cauliflower were amazing and paired so well with the drinks. But what made everything 100% was the view. The view of the LA from the patio seating is unbeatable. And the service as well. Can't say enough good things and will be back!

Came twice both during lunch time. They are extremely generous with the amount of clams given in the clam linguine, and imo their oysters top the charts. It's so fresh and succulent! Steak was well handled though the steak cut wasn't the best. We also tried their truffle risotto and seabass, both which have their flavours very well balanced. Crispy chicken with waffle was so crispy! Overall great quality for the price.

I took my girl to Tesse for Valentine’s Day and we had the worst outdoor dining experience ever. It was up on the hill and they set up the dining area on an open field between two buildings without any windbreak. It was freezing cold and the wind just kept blowing to our face. The heaters were pretty useless because they were way too high above the table which we couldn’t really feel the heat. We waited over an hour in the wind for our first main course (lamb Carre) to come. And it went cold pretty much immediately after it was put on the table because of the wind. We couldn’t stand it any longer so we left with the rest of the food to-go. The food still sitting in the fridge (we got sick from sitting in the wind and lost our appetite completely) Valentine’s Day dinner was ruined we both got sick the next day. I would give 0/5 for the experience if that is an option. That one star is for the staff who worked outside in the wind all night.

Came here for brunch, great setting and atmosphere. Restaurant is inspired by French cuisine but with a fusion flare. Our favorite by far was the wild rice, the hummus in the frenchy pizza was great. Everything else was nicely done. An amazing wine selection and cocktails came highly recommended, but no designated driver so we passed on drinks today. Validation done for adjacent parking lot, and right outside you get a good view of the city. Great place for brunch and I'm sure the dinner menu will be good as well.
